How much does a Records Management Specialist make in New Mexico?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a Records Management Specialist in New Mexico is $37,346 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$18.

However, a Records Management Specialist's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$44,265
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$33,320 to $40,968
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$29,654

Records Management Specialist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Records Management Specialist ro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 45%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Internet and Pharmaceuticals s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 20% above the average. In contrast, Records Management Specialist positions in Edu., Gov't. & Nonprofit or Hospitality & Leisure typ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Records Management Specialist as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.
